Group insists Gov Akeredolu Cannot Work in Oyo

The Ondo Solidarity Forum (OSF) in Ondo State has strongly criticized the recent relocation of governance from Akure to Ibadan, enabling Governor Rotimi Akeredolu to return to office while he is still recovering from an ailment.

According to the Nation paper, OSF, through its acting chairman, Honorable Femi Ogunleye, and publicity secretary, Prince Kayode Fasua, described this move as a show of shame and a manipulation by influential individuals within the state.

While the group wishes Governor Akeredolu a speedy recovery, they question the urgency of his return to office. They emphasize that the function of the legs is to walk, not the head. Governor Akeredolu has returned to Nigeria and is resting in his Ibadan residence, so there is no need to rush his resumption of office.

OSF criticizes the spectacle of cabinet members, legislative members, and aides being transported from Akure to Ibadan in a convoy of vehicles to proclaim his resumption as governor.

They argue that if the governor were truly fit, he would have returned to Akure and resumed his duties there.

The group expresses concern about a potential power shift to a cabal within the state, suggesting that influential individuals are manipulating the situation to their advantage. They believe that this move undermines democracy and the rightful governance of the state.

They call for a more transparent and democratic approach to governance during the governor’s recovery.
